Capture Western Blots and More with the New ChemiDoc-ItTS3 Imager
Jul 06 2016
The ChemiDoc-ItTS3 Imager features simple and automated imaging with a deeply cooled (-57?C from ambient), 8.1MP camera, for the finest detection and capture of chemiluminescent western blots, fluorescent westerns, colorimetric gels, and multiplex imaging.
Imagers are equipped with a large 15.6” touch interface and easy-to-use software, with One-Touch templates for automation of capture settings. Several settings optimise image capture with numerous integration/exposure settings and the capability to capture a sequence of images. The software features new and advanced compositing tools for multi-channel image capture. Conveniently save images to the imager, to USB or a network computer.
The darkroom contains a new height adjustable blot tray for close-up imaging. Filter selection is easy and automated in a five position filter wheel. Transilluminator options include 1UV (302nm), 2UV (302/365nm) or UVP’s patented 3UV™ (254/302/365nm) technology, with filter sizes up to 25x26cm. Overhead white lighting is included, with optional UV light.
The ChemiDoc-ItTS3 is now upgradeable for expanded applications. Add a BioLite® Light Source to support RGB, Near IR and other multiplex applications.
